Course Overview

Guided Tour of Machine Learning in Finance is offered by Coursera for intermediate-level students and learners to know the application of machine learning in finance. The online programme is the first programme in the Machine Learning and Reinforcement Learning in Finance Specialization offered by New York University and the Guided Tour of Machine Learning in Finance Certification Course can also be taken as a separate single programme. 

Provided by Coursera, Guided Tour of Machine Learning in Finance Training will shed light on machine learning and the application of ML to cope with various financial problems. Though the Guided Tour of Machine Learning in Finance Certification by Coursera is offered for intermediate learners, it is very needed for the learners to have an understanding and experience of Pythonlinear algebra, basic probability theory, and basic calculus to successfully complete the assignments.

What you will learn

Machine learning

Guided Tour of Machine Learning in Finance Certification Syllabus will guide you through machine learning concepts, the application of machine learning to Finance, the process of solving financial problems with the help of machine learning, and the like. Likewise, the course will facilitate the students to know the advances in financial machine learning, deep learning in finance, machine learning for finance in python, and many more. Plus, the learners will have practical knowledge through capstone projects where the learners will be assigned to make predictions of bank closures using the Supervised Machine Learning methods.

The Syllabus

Videos
  • Welcome Note
  • Specialization Objectives
  • Specialization Prerequisites
  •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ning, Part I
  •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ning, Part II
  • Machine Learning as a Foundation of Artificial Intelligence, Part I
  • Machine Learning as a Foundation of Artificial Intelligence, Part II
  • Machine Learning as a Foundation of Artificial Intelligence, Part III
  • Machine Learning in Finance vs Machine Learning in Tech, Part I
  • Machine Learning in Finance vs Machine Learning in Tech, Part II
  • Machine Learning in Finance vs Machine Learning in Tech, Part III
Readings
  • The Business of Artificial Intelligence
  • How AI and Automation Will Shape Finance in the Future
  • A. Geron, “Hands-On Machine Learning with Scikit-Learn and TensorFlow”, Chapter 1
Practice Exercise
  • Module 1 Quiz

Videos
  • Generalization and a Bias-Variance Tradeoff
  • The No Free Lunch Theorem
  • Overfitting and Model Capacity
  • Linear Regression
  • Regularization, Validation Set, and Hyper-parameters
  • Overview of the Supervised Machine Learning in Finance
Readings
  • I. Goodfellow, Y. Bengio, A. Courville, “Deep Learning”, Chapters 4.5, 5.1, 5.2, 5.3, 5.4
  • Leo Breiman, “Statistical Modeling: The Two Cultures”
  • Jupyter Notebook FAQ
Practice Exercise
  • Module 2 Quiz

Videos
  • DataFlow and TensorFlow
  • A First Demo of TensorFlow
  • Linear Regression in TensorFlow
  • Neural Networks
  • Gradient Descent Optimization
  • Gradient Descent for Neural Networks
  • Stochastic Gradient Descent
Readings
  • A.Geron, “Hands-On ML”, Chapter 9, Chapter 4 (Gradient Descent)
  • E. Fama and K. French, “Size and Book-to-Market Factors in Earnings and Returns”, Journal of Finance, vol. 50, no. 1 (1995), pp. 131-155.
  • J. Piotroski, “Value Investing: The Use of Historical Financial Statement Information to Separate Winners from Losers”, Journal of Accounting Research, Vol. 38, Supplement: Studies on Accounting Information and the Economics of the Firm (2000), pp. 1-41
  • Jupyter Notebook FAQ
Practice Exercise
  • Module 3 Quiz

Videos
  • Regression and Equity Analysis
  • Fundamental Analysis
  • Machine Learning as Model Estimation
  • Maximum Likelihood Estimation1
  • Probabilistic Classification Models
  • Logistic Regression for Modeling Bank Failures, Part I
  • Logistic Regression for Modeling Bank Failures, Part II
  • Logistic Regression for Modeling Bank Failures, Part III
  • Supervised Learning: Conclusion
Readings
  • C. Bishop, “Pattern Recognition and Machine Learning”, Chapters 4.1, 4.2, 4.3
  • A. Geron, “Hands-On ML”, Chapters 3, Chapter 4 (Logistic Regression)
  • Jupyter Notebook FAQ
  • Jupyter Notebook FAQ
Practice Exercise
  • Module 4 Quiz
